The pop superstar is apologizing today after she stuck her foot in her mouth and called her son Rocco Ritchie – who is white – the N-word via Instagram (scroll down to see it).

“No one messes with Dirty Soap!” she captioned a photo of her 13-year-old son during a boxing workout Friday. “Mama said knock you out! #disnigga”

Huh? What? Why. Well now, Madonna, 55 is apologizing for her choice of words.

“I am sorry if I offended anyone with my use of the N-word on Instagram,” she said in a statement Saturday to E! News. “It was not meant as a racial slur … I am not a racist.”

She added: “There’s no way to defend the use of the word. It was all about intention … it was used as a term of endearment toward my son who is white. I appreciate that it’s a provocative word and I apologize if it gave people the wrong impression. Forgive me.”

According to Buzzfeed, the “Justify My Love” singer immediately deleted the post when it began causing an uproar, 

While some dismissed her comment as ignorance, others felt she should apologize for her use of the N-word, period.

“I don’t have people policing me because I am not a celebrity with millions of fans all over the world,” @kinkaloe wrote on Instagram. “This is f–king Madge, she is a legend, people are watching her and WILL comment if she says something ignorant.”
